iShares Core Hang Seng Index ETF (03115.HK) Edges Down 0.06% to HK$94.780
New time space News, according to the latest data from the HKEX, as of 16:24 on April 27, the iSharesCoreHang Seng Index ETF (03115.HK) declined 0.06% to a trading price of HK$94.780. The intraday high was HK$96.280 and the low was HK$94.360, with an average price of HK$94.827. The total AUM stands at approximately HK$2.355 billion, with the latest Net Asset Value (NAV) per unit at HK$94.784, representing a premium of +0.06%.
TheiSharesCoreHang Seng Index ETF (03115.HK) tracks the Hang Seng Index (HSI), the oldest and most widely recognized blue-chip benchmark for the Hong Kong stock market. The index is composed of the largest and most liquid high-quality companies listed on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ange. Currently featuring 82 constituent stocks (with an ultimate target of 100), the index ensures broad representation across core sectors—including Finance, Information Technology, Real Estate, Consumer Discretionary, and Telecommunications—by selecting samples based on industry groups.
As a "barometer" for the health of Hong Kong's capital markets and a core metric for the performance of offshore Chinese assets, the HSI is not only the cornerstone for global institutional investors allocating assets to Hong Kong stocks but also one of the most internationalized indices with the highest market recognition and the largest number of linked derivative products.
